A teenager has been charged with the robbery of a gold necklace on July 11.

The 17-year-old was arrested during an Operation Target patrol after reports of a robbery at 11.15am on Monday.

An 18-year-old man and 17-year-old boy were arrested in connection with the incident.

The 18-year-old was released without charge, but the other boy was charged yesterday and is due to appear at Croydon Youth Court today.

DS Simon French from Croydon's Robbery Squad said: "Robbery is one of the crimes that is the focus of Operation Target here in Croydon. We're conduction patrols in the areas we know robbers are operating and having the assistance of officers from units like the DPG is making a real impact on the streets."
